## Scanwright 4.2 — Changed defaults

Breaking for plugin authors. Barcode scanner integration now defaults to continuous-scan mode; single-shot must be requested explicitly. Symbology auto-detect is on by default, and the legacy beep callback is removed. Plugins targeting 4.1 behavior must pin the compatibility flag before init. New defaults ship as listed in the configuration below.

config for fajof-badug:
holael:
  log_level: error
  metrics_host: metrics.holael.tolvaqsys.internal
  pool_size: 32

**Q: Who can access the first-aid room, and how?**

For the facilities desk: the first-aid room at Larchdene Court is on the ground floor behind reception, next to the quiet room. Trained first-aiders from the Wrenfold team have standing access, but facilities staff can open it any time — it's never meant to be fully locked out during working hours. Restock requests go through the usual supplies form; check the cabinet seal weekly and note it in the log. To unlock the door, tap your badge and key in the code below.

door code, kawip-bagap: bdg-HQEWH-4

## Authentication

Archiving cold storage buckets on Frostvale is a one-way trip, so double-check the bucket list before running `frost archive`. The CLI talks to the vault API, which won't accept anonymous calls even for dry runs. Set the auth header yourself if the CLI prompt annoys you, using the bearer token below.

session JWT of yawep-yawep = eyJhbGciOiJIUzI1NiIsInR5cCI6IkpXVCJ9.eyJzdWIiOiI3pWF3_In0.aXYsHiog

## Onboarding: Hallowick Profile Store Sharding

The Hallowick user-profile store is sharded by a salted hash of the account ID across twelve partitions. Rebalancing runs nightly and is audited; no shard may be read cross-region without review. If the shard coordinator loses quorum during your review session, restore access through the sealed recovery console using the passphrase that follows.

unlock words, yawig-kagef: gordor-holvan-ulaael-pramir-ulaiel-tamdor

Facilities Ticket — Cleaning Crew Access, Brindle Annex

For new starters handling evening lock-up: the Sorano Cleaning crew arrives nightly at 21:30 via the annex side door. Check their rota sheet, note arrival in the log, and ensure the storeroom is relocked afterward. To let them through the side door, enter the access code below.

badge for yaweg-hafog: bdg-GX-6